Output 80236892881fc06d7e7c756dce8abf1f32b8a8596d3edbf5eae2b7933e6ad04c:3

value
39402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8190b7b89849d2ff447ffb8cd456a6f6d2ecf199 OP_EQUAL
address
3DW6TT1NpqZA1HJniWBpYTLUkrG8p9d2Sx
transaction
80236892881fc06d7e7c756dce8abf1f32b8a8596d3edbf5eae2b7933e6ad04c
spent
true